About This Audiobook

Dive into ‘An Autobiography of Trauma’ by Peter A. Levine, narrated by Christopher Salazar, where personal resilience meets therapeutic breakthroughs. This intense yet enlightening memoir delves deep into the author's journey from childhood trauma to developing Somatic Experiencing—a revolutionary approach to healing. The narration is both soothing and compelling, making complex concepts accessible through Salazar’s nuanced performance. Uniquely, it explores how science, philosophy, and personal experience converge in the quest for inner peace.

Editor's Review ★★★★☆

AudioBook Atlas

Christopher Salazar's captivating narration brings Levine’s profound story to life with warmth and sensitivity. His ability to modulate tone perfectly aligns with the emotional landscape of the narrative, making it both engaging and deeply relatable. The book is a masterclass in personal storytelling, blending scientific insights with poignant reflections on trauma and healing. However, some sections can feel overly technical for casual listeners, which might require patience. Overall, ‘An Autobiography of Trauma’ is a must-listen for anyone seeking understanding and hope through their own struggles.
